yield 4 serving(s)
prep time 10 Min
cook time 1 Hr
method Bake

Ingredients For green chili chicken enchiladas

  • 1 Tbsp
    ground cumin
  • 1 tsp
    coriander, or 1/4 cup fresh chopped cilantro
  • 1 tsp
    onion powder
  • 1 tsp
    minced garlic
  • 1 tsp
    seasoned salt
  • 4 oz
    chopped green chilis
  • juice of one lime
  • 2
    boneless sk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 can
    green enchilada sauce
  • 4
    flour tortillas, 8-10 inches
  • 2 c
    monterey jack cheese, shredded.

How To Make green chili chicken enchiladas

  • 1
    Mix first 6 ingredients and lime juice in medium saucepan. Add chicken breasts and cook over medium heat until done, about 25-30 minutes.
  • 2
    Shred chicken and return to saucepan. Mix to coat chicken.
  • 3
    Divide chicken between 4 tortillas. Top with 1/8 cup cheese. Roll tortillas and place in greased 11x7 baking dish. Pour enchilada sauce over tortillas and top with remaining cheese.
  • 4
    Bake at 350° for 20-30 minutes until heated through and cheese is melted.
